I didn’t notice how busy I’ve been until I wrote it all down one day at jury duty a few months ago. The questionnaire wanted to know what I did for a living. That’s such a hard question for me because a lot of what I spend my time on would actually be categorized as volunteer work. I am on the board of a parent organization at my son’s high school. I serve at our church both as a volunteer and paid staff. I show up to serve (not as often as I’d like) to my daughter’s school, too. I meet up with parishoners and friends for dinners, lunches, coffee. I still have one foot in my secular career (legal technology) and maintain my LinkedIn profile as such. Most of the time, I simply ask for prayers to keep up with all that I’m doing and hope that it’s all making a difference for my family and friends as well as people I’ll never meet.
